Honeygrow App is easy to navigate, very user friendly for a low tech user like me. Signing up is not required. I can place orders as guests. The app accepts Apple Pay from my phone making check outs extra fast. The order went to store real time and make the food ready to pickup on time as promised. I can also schedule / pick my time when to pick up too. Good, easy app. Overall no complaints.

I ordered delivery through the app this weekend which was to be delivered by DoorDash. I do not use the DoorDash app at all and only after ordering was I a sent a text with DoorDash tracking info, otherwise I would have had no idea who the courier was. The courier approached my house in the car and marked the order delivered according to the tracking, but the food was not dropped off. In the honeygrow app there is no way to see the status of past delivery orders, and no way to connect with a representative for a resolution through the honeygrow app where you pay for the food and delivery. When I called the store there was no recourse, the manager could not refund or re-deliver. The manager also could not answer whether honeygrow had my money or DoorDash did. He suggested I call DoorDash for a resolution when I had never even touched the DoorDash app. DoorDash did not provide a phone number with the tracking to call to resolve any issues. If there is a problem with your delivery order placed through hg it is in the ether. The app is aesthetically pleasing and functional for ordering but useless for seeing order history or trying to resolve a problem.
